¿Qué hace? is often used as a funny way to greet someone in phrases like Hola, ¿qué hace? ¿Durmiendo o qué hace? (literally Hey, what're you doing?Sleeping or what're you doing?). You'll also see this phrase in memes featuring a llama asking questions like that shown above, although with incorrect spelling and punctuation: Ola k ase? Durmiendo o …

Here is the most common way to ask someone what they are doing. The literal translation of ‘Qué haces? ’ is “What are you doing?” If you write this you need to put the tilde over the ‘e.’ If you fail to write the accent mark on the ‘e’ it is incorrect.
